Abstract: A monolithic antenna structure, comprising: a first metal layer; a second metal layer; a third metal layer arranged as a ground plane; a first dielectric layer between the first metal layer and the second metal layer; a second dielectric layer between the second metal layer and the third metal layer; a via feeding a signal for transmission by the antenna structure through the second dielectric layer to the second metal layer; wherein the first metal layer and the second metal layer are not electrically connected; and wherein the first metal layer acts primarily as the radiating element of the monolithic antenna structure.
Abstract: A RU for mMIMO has M antenna branches; a plurality of partial digital beamforming (PDBF) processors, each PDBF processor receiving a transmit vector comprising values for each of L data layers to be transmitted at time t from the RU via the antenna branches, wherein each of the plurality of PDBF processors performs a beamforming operation on the vector by multiplying the vector with each of a plurality of respective weight vectors that are a subset of a received weight array, to produce scalar values, each scalar value corresponding to one of the weight vectors and being supplied to a respective antenna branch; wherein the number of scalar values produced by any particular one of the PDBF processors equals the number of weight vectors used in each PDBF processor and the number of scalar values produced is equal to M; where L and M are greater than one.
